Transaction 23be4183c2928eba1197914ded505acfe76f157c0f77176e709aa33f45b59d0b

1 Input
2 Outputs
  • 23be4183c2928eba1197914ded505acfe76f157c0f77176e709aa33f45b59d0b:0
  • value  220969
    address  37aVjs7vy3BcD4dEAAmPYJQPRrTuh2BZr4
  • 23be4183c2928eba1197914ded505acfe76f157c0f77176e709aa33f45b59d0b:1
  • value  5904974
    address  37szPz4nbFwUFEGCbPHoh8AL3jMn6kAboB